    Default Acclimation of online order

    I got some zoa and a bubble coral in the mail today and just wanted to make sure I don't need to do something special to acclimate them. I have them in the tank in their bags and will let sit for 15 min, then add some of my tank water and sit for another 15, and then do this one or two more times.

    Any tips???

    Default RE: Acclimation of online order

    id drip acclimate em. google that. thats what i do with most of my coral then dip em and put em in do not put the shipping h20 in the tank

    Default RE: Acclimation of online order

    its easy to drip them. run some aquarium tubing from your tank to a valve that adjusts, then siphon it. Set it to a moderate drip, and yer done. I have a dripper bucket, but I use that if I am doing salinity changes/adding more water etc. The dripper bucket is easy design as well. Take a cheap bucket, pop a small hole in the bottom. Put a T valve in itwith the double ended part in the bucket, and attach aquarium tube to the outside. seal it. done.

    Default RE: Acclimation of online order

    I also suggest drip acclimating. I don't even use a valve I just tie a knot in the tubing and start the siphon. The tighter the knot the slower the drip.
